Hücrenin metnini Nasıl Döndürülür

Hücre Metnini Döndürmek Aspose.Cells for Node.js via C++ ile

Aspose.Cells, geliştiricilerin Excel elektronik tablolarıyla programatik olarak çalışmasına imkan tanıyan güçlü bir Node.js bileşenidir. Aspose.Cells’in sunduğu özelliklerden biri hücreleri döndürme yeteneğidir, böylece metnin yönünü özelleştirebilir ve görsel sunumu geliştirebilirsiniz. Bu belgede, Aspose.Cells kullanarak hücreleri nasıl döndürürüz gösterilecektir.

Excel’de Hücrenin Metnini Döndürme

Bir hücreyi Excel’de döndürmek için aşağıdaki adımları kullanabilirsiniz:

  1. Excel’i açın ve döndürmek istediğiniz hücreyi veya hücre aralığını seçin.
  2. Seçilen hücre(ler)e sağ tıklayın ve bağlam menüsünden “Hücreleri Biçimlendir”‘i seçin. Alternatif olarak, Excel şeridinde “Ana Sayfa” sekmesine gidip “Hücreler” grubundaki “Biçimlamanın” açılır menüsüne tıklayıp “Hücreleri Biçimlendir”‘i seçebilirsiniz.
  3. “Hücreleri Biçimlendir” iletişim kutusunda, “Hizalama” sekmesine gidin.
  4. “Yönlendirme” bölümünde, metni döndürebileceğiniz seçenekleri göreceksiniz. “Derece” kutusuna istenen dönme açısını doğrudan girebilirsiniz. Pozitif değerler metni saat yönünün tersine döndürür, negatif değerler ise saat yönünde döndürür.
    todo:image_alt_text
  5. İstenilen yönlendirmeyi seçtikten sonra, değişiklikleri uygulamak için “Tamam”‘a tıklayın. Seçilen hücre(ler) artık seçtiğiniz dönme açısına veya yönlendirmeye göre dönecektir.

Aspose.Cells API kullanarak Hücrenin Metnini Döndürme

Style.setRotationAngle(number) özelliği hücreleri döndürmeyi kolaylaştırır. Aspose.Cells’te hücreleri döndürmek için şu adımları izlemeniz gerekir:

  1. Excel Çalışma Kitabını Yükle

    İlk olarak, mevcut bir Excel dosyasını açmak veya yeni bir tane oluşturmak için Workbook sınıfını kullanarak Excel çalışma kitabını yüklemeniz gerekir.

  2. Çalışma Sayfasına Eriş

    Çalışma kitabı yüklendikten sonra, hücreleri döndürmek istediğiniz çalışma sayfasına erişmeniz gerekir. Çalışma sayfasına endeksine veya adına göre erişebilirsiniz.

  3. Hücrenin metnini döndür

    Artık çalışma sayfasına erişiminiz olduğuna göre, istenen hücrelerin Stil objesini değiştirerek hücreleri döndürebilirsiniz. Stil objesi, dönme dahil çeşitli biçimlendirme seçeneklerini belirlemenizi sağlar.

  4. Çalışma Kitabını Kaydet

    Hücreleri döndürdükten sonra, değiştirilmiş çalışma kitabını Save metodunu kullanarak bir dosyaya veya akıma geri kaydedebilirsiniz.

Node.js Örnek Kodu

Aşağıdaki kodu inceleyin, bir çalışma kitabı nesnesi oluşturur ve birkaç hücre için farklı dönüş açıları ayarlar. Ekran görüntüsü, örnek kodun çalıştırılmasının ardından sonucu gösterir.

const AsposeCells = require("aspose.cells.node");
// Loads the workbook which contains hidden external links
const workbook = new AsposeCells.Workbook();
// Obtaining the reference of the newly added worksheet
const worksheet = workbook.getWorksheets().get(0);
// Row index of the cell
let row = 0;
// Column index of the cell
let column = 0;
let a1 = worksheet.getCells().get(row, column);
a1.putValue("a1 rotate text");
let a1Style = a1.getStyle();
// Set the rotation angle in degrees
a1Style.setRotationAngle(45);
a1.setStyle(a1Style);
// set Column index of the cell
column = 1;
let b1 = worksheet.getCells().get(row, column);
b1.putValue("b1 rotate text");
let b1Style = b1.getStyle();
// Set the rotation angle in degrees
b1Style.setRotationAngle(255);
b1.setStyle(b1Style);
// set Column index of the cell
column = 2;
let c1 = worksheet.getCells().get(row, column);
c1.putValue("c1 rotate text");
let c1Style = c1.getStyle();
// Set the rotation angle in degrees
c1Style.setRotationAngle(-90);
c1.setStyle(c1Style);
// set Column index of the cell
column = 3;
let d1 = worksheet.getCells().get(row, column);
d1.putValue("d1 rotate text");
let d1Style = d1.getStyle();
// Set the rotation angle in degrees
d1Style.setRotationAngle(-90);
d1.setStyle(d1Style);
workbook.save("out.xlsx");